Cox Gallery – Seeing in Darjeeling

Works on canvas En Plein Air

Open Mon-Fri 9am-5pm, until Friday 15 July

Cox Gallery, 1/19 Eastlake Parade, Kingston ACT

This exhibition is a result of four friends inviting prominent landscape artist Robert Malherbe to come with them to Darjeeling to paint. Peter Dunn, Rob Purdon, Diana McPhetres and Rodney Moss gave Robert a brief – “show us how to see things differently”.

Darjeeling is a historic hill station in northern India at the foothills of the Himalayas with spectacular views up into the mountains. The challenge for the group was to paint the space and light of this special mountain town “en plein air”.

The paintings are all in acrylic and show a range of works demonstrating the vigour and passion of the enthusiastic beginner and the accomplished refinement of the mature artist.

The paintings capture the unique qualities of Darjeeling – the enormous scale of the place, the contrast in light, the bold colours and the gritty urban form of the town.
